开发环境下SSL的证书有关问题怎么解决

开发环境下SSL的证书问题如何解决
之前没有做过ssl的部署,现在由于登录站点需求,需要部署成https
我在iis7中新建站点时是可以选择https发布,但是这下好了,浏览器都不信任
特别是ie,报红页,就算进去了页面也有乱掉,而且普通的http请求的外链都无法请求

现在的测试站点部署在局域网的一台win2008+iis7上面,测试只能用chorme并且加上--allow-running-insecure-content受信任标志才能正常访问

请问各位大神这种情况下如何解决,能够在ie,ff上均能正常请求呢
是要自制签名证书呢  还是直接用iis7自带的localhost证书设置一些东西即可

------解决方案--------------------
让老板花钱再买一个ssl装在测试环境上就是了。
 $59.99/year

或者测试环境就不要用https也行啊。